Three Palestinians were killed on Thursday when an Israeli drone strike hit a tent sheltering displaced civilians in southern Gaza, in the latest violation of last year’s ceasefire deal, according to a local emergency service, Anadolu reports. The Gaza Civil Defense and Emergency Directorate said in a brief statement that the strike targeted a tent in the Al-Mawasi area of Khan Younis, killing three people at the scene. Al-Mawasi has been designated by Israel as a so-called “safe zone,” yet it has continued to come under attack. Earlier on Thursday, Israeli forces killed a Palestinian child in a separate attack in the northern Gaza Strip, according to medical sources.
